Overcoming Integration and Adoption Challenges
Transitioning to a unified platform like Milagro is not without obstacles. Integrating with existing POS systems or third-party apps can be complex, particularly when locations use varied configurations. Additionally, staff training poses a challenge, as teams range from tech-savvy younger workers to seasoned employees accustomed to manual processes. Milagro addresses this with a modular onboarding approach, allowing teams to adopt the system gradually without disruption.
Data security and governance are also critical. With sensitive metrics like sales and labor costs flowing across multiple locations, robust access controls are essential. Milagro’s tiered permissions ensure that only authorized personnel from district managers to frontline staff access relevant data. This not only enhances security but also streamlines decision-making by providing clarity in a data-rich environment.
Milagro also balances corporate oversight with local autonomy. Franchisees can customize promotions or menus to suit their market while headquarters maintains brand consistency, ensuring a cohesive customer experience across all locations.
The Ripple Effects: Efficiency and Brand Strength
Milagro’s unified approach delivers measurable benefits across operations. Labor optimization is a standout feature, with shared scheduling tools analyzing traffic patterns to align shifts with peak hours. One operator reduced labor costs significantly without compromising service quality. Inventory management sees similar gains, with enterprise-level insights preventing overstocking or shortages. This means less food waste and fewer disruptions during peak service times.
Brand consistency, often eroded by rapid expansion, is another area where Milagro excels. Shared CRM and feedback tools ensure that every location delivers the same experience, whether it’s a casual taco chain or an upscale steakhouse. Advanced analytics further empower operators to forecast trends, identify outliers, and pinpoint operational inefficiencies such as why one location’s signature dish is underperforming.
